Browsing howwood, United Kingdom business
Bearsden, Glasgow | Kilmarnock, G61 2AF
Bearsden, Glasgow | East Kilbride, Glasgow, G61 2AF
1, Kilkerran Way, Newton Mearns, Glasgow | Glasgow, G77 6ZT
Bearsden, Glasgow | Glasgow, G61 2AF
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ood